TYPE C female seat 24PIN sinking plate ultra-thin model with exposed tongue and lock hole CH=0.25

TYPE C female seat 24PIN sinking plate ultra-thin model with exposed tongue and lock hole CH=0.25 is a highly integrated connector designed for extremely ultra-thin devices. The sinking plate structure achieves an ultra-low height of CH=0.25mm (distance from the tongue to the PCB board), with an exposed tongue design to ensure stable contact between the male head. The locking hole can be fixed with screws to enhance installation reliability; The 24PIN fully functional pin supports high-speed transmission and fast charging, and is widely used in scenarios such as smart watches, AR glasses, ultra-thin medical instruments that are sensitive to thickness and require stable connections.

    Interface and protocol compliance: Compliant with the USB Implementers Forum (USB-IF) USB4.0 specification and PD 3.0 standard, passed USB-IF compatibility testing to ensure compatibility with various TYPE C male and fast charging devices, avoiding transmission interruptions and protocol incompatibility issues.
    Environmental compliance: Fully compliant with EU RoHS 3.0 (2015/863/EU) and Chinese GB/T 26572-2011, strictly restricting 10 harmful substances such as lead, mercury, cadmium, etc. Raw materials (metals, LCP, coatings) have passed SGS environmental testing and provided compliance reports.
    Electrical safety compliance: comply with IEC 62368-1 safety standard, insulation resistance ≥ 1000M Ω (500V DC), withstand voltage ≥ 500V AC (no breakdown for 1 minute); Electromagnetic shielding effectiveness ≥ 50dB (1GHz frequency band), meets FCC Part 15 Class B EMC requirements, and avoids interference with sensitive components inside the equipment (such as Bluetooth modules and sensors).
    Production quality compliance: Following the ISO 9001 system, the entire process is tested (dimensional accuracy, conductivity, insertion and extraction force), with 500pcs sampled from each batch and a failure rate of ≤ 0.2%. Batch quality inspection reports can be provided.

    Storage and transportation
    Storage environment: Temperature -5 ℃~35 ℃, relative humidity 25%~55%. Avoid high temperature and humidity, direct sunlight, or contact with dust/corrosive gases (such as sweat and alcohol) to prevent terminal oxidation and aging of LCP base.
    Transportation requirements: Anti static shielding bag+anti-static tray packaging, each plate contains 500pcs, with built-in moisture-proof agent and "Handle with care" and "Anti static" labels affixed to the outside to avoid deformation of the lock hole and bending of the tongue due to compression.
    After opening: Unused products must be resealed within 12 hours and exposed to air for no more than 24 hours to prevent dust from adhering and affecting welding or contact performance.
    Installation operation
    PCB design: The groove depth of the sinking board should match the CH value (0.25mm ± 0.02mm), and a 1.3mm diameter through-hole (tolerance ± 0.05mm) should be reserved at the PCB position corresponding to the lock hole; High speed differential lines require impedance control of 100 Ω± 10% and line length matching error of ≤ 30mil (due to equipment miniaturization, wiring needs to be more compact).
    Reflow soldering parameters: preheating section 120-150 ℃ (40-60 seconds), peak section 250-260 ℃ (≤ 6 seconds), cooling rate ≤ 2 ℃/second, to prevent deformation of LCP base and terminal detachment caused by high temperature (ultra-thin structure is more sensitive to temperature).
    Post installation inspection: Use a high-power microscope (≥ 50x) to check whether the tongue is flat (tilt ≤ 0.05mm) and whether the lock hole is aligned with the PCB through-hole, in order to avoid damaging the mother seat during subsequent screw installation.
    Operation and Maintenance
    Current limit: VBUS power supply should not exceed 2.25A (at 20V) to avoid overloading and overheating of terminals (ultra-thin structure with small heat dissipation area requires strict control of current).
    Insertion and extraction specifications: Vertical insertion and extraction is required, and tilting or rotating force is prohibited. Although the exposed tongue design enhances contact, excessive force can easily cause the tongue to break (it is recommended to control the insertion and extraction life within 8000 times).
    Cleaning and maintenance: When there are stains on the interface, gently wipe it with a dry and dust-free cloth. Do not rinse with water or cleaning agents to prevent liquid from seeping into the gap between the sink plates and causing short circuits.
    Taboos
    It is prohibited to polish or trim tongue plates or lock holes without authorization, otherwise it will damage the structural strength and contact performance, causing the equipment to be unrecognizable or power supply to be interrupted.
    It is prohibited to use it in underwater, high temperature (>85 ℃) or severe vibration scenarios (such as car engine compartments). Special protection models (IP67 or above) must be selected for such scenarios.
    When deformation of the tongue, sliding teeth in the lock hole, or poor contact (such as frequent disconnection of the equipment) is found, immediately replace the female seat with a new one to avoid damaging the male head or equipment motherboard.
